Steve Sarvi

Steve Sarvi

The mayor of Watertown from 2000 to 2005, Steve Sarvi also has been the city administrator in Lanesboro, Watertown and Victoria. He served in the military for 20 years -- with the Army Reserves, the full-time Army and the National Guard. As a Guard member, he served for 16 months in Iraq and was part of the peacekeeping force in Kosovo.

His campaign argues that the low-key incumbent Kline, campaigning softly, depicting himself as a grandfatherly fellow suburbanite, is in fact every bit as conservative as his more full-throated colleagues -- and increasingly out of a sync with the district. Sarvi is stressing his military service and seeks to cast Kline as an ally of President Bush and corporate interests.

Sarvi's challenge will be to find eye-catching issues in a district that leans rightward.

Date of birth: January 30, 1965

Family: Wife Barb; 3 school-age children

Education: B.A., political science, University of Minnesota-Twin Cities

Career: Mayor of Watertown, 2000-2005; city administrator, Lanesboro, Watertown and Victoria, 1994-2008; Army Reserve, active duty Army, Army National Guard for total of 20 years
